COMING BACK HOME

   Call of career compelled to go abroad, carrying confusion.
   Onward progress permitted no limitation.
   Memories, reminiscences in series only to ruminate.
   Inevitable detachment from homely ambient.
   Nostalgia pricked pierced painful heart.
   Grieved to get uprooted from familiar soil.
   Bird yearned to fly free frolic, soaring high.
   Ambition pulled me far away surpassing sentiment.
   Carefree endeavor did not allow home sickness.
   Key of success to access, I fled from home.
   Humble heart hankered for heroic achievement.
   Ocean fathomless waited to be explored.
   Most important to touch summit of my goal.
   End of journey rejoiced coming back home.
